摘要
A piezoelectric resonator adapted for use in the band from several hundreds of kilohertz to 2 MHz utilizes a newly discovered width vibration mode and permits use of a simplified support structure which reduces stress on the resonator and reduces the overall size of the resonator. The resonator has a substantially rectangular cross-sectional shape having a pair of shorter sides and a pair of longer sides. To achieve the newly discovered vibration mode, the ratio of the length b of the longer sides to the length a of the shorter sides is set to be within +10% of a value given byPPb/a=n(-2.70&sgr;+2.86) P Pwhere n is an integer and &sgr; is the Poisson's ratio of the ymaterial used to form the resonator.
